Context: Tensions between the US and Iran have driven up Brent crude prices to $90. The escalating situation is also impacting other energy markets. The effects of these tensions are being closely watched by investors and analysts.
Key Facts
- Brent crude prices have surged to $90 due to the heightened tensions between the US and Iran.
- West Texas Intermediate (WTI) crude is projected to reach $110 by July 2026, according to a forecast.
- The strengthening dollar is another consequence of the US-Iran tensions, although specific details on the dollar's current value or changes are not provided.
